Commissioners Court Worksession Agendas
The Bexar County Commissioners Court will meet to certify the results of the November 7, 2023, elections. The court will also consider a Master Economic Incentives Agreement for the redevelopment of the former Windsor Park Mall. Additionally, officials will discuss the county's legislative program and community funding requests.
- Certification of 14 Amendment results from the November 7, 2023, election
- Master Economic Incentives Agreement for the redevelopment of the former Windsor Park Mall
- Agreement involving Bexar County, City of Windcrest, and Industrial Commercial Properties, LLC
- Discussion of the Legislative Program for the 118th United States Congress
- Discussion of Fiscal Year 2024/25 Community Funding Requests

Commissioners Court Worksession Agendas
The Commissioners Court will discuss contract amendments with the Deputy Sheriff's Association of Bexar County. The proposed changes involve the "Straight to the Streets" program and adjustments to Step Pay Plans for Law Enforcement and Adult Detention.
- Contract amendments regarding Article 9 (Wages and Benefits) and Article 25 (Transfers into Law Enforcement)
- Implementation of the "Straight to the Streets" program
- Adjustments to Step Pay Plans for Law Enforcement and Adult Detention
- Estimated annual cost of $9.6 million
